diff --git a/public/index.html b/public/index.html index 36afe3f95..cd4ada852 100644 --- a/public/index.html +++ b/public/index.html @@ -19,12 +19,11 @@ - +
-
diff --git a/src/js/controllers/disclaimer.js b/src/js/controllers/disclaimer.js index d125f8d06..388906ab7 100644 --- a/src/js/controllers/disclaimer.js +++ b/src/js/controllers/disclaimer.js @@ -1,7 +1,7 @@ 'use strict'; angular.module('copayApp.controllers').controller('disclaimerController', - function($scope, $timeout, $log, $ionicSideMenuDelegate, profileService, applicationService, gettextCatalog, uxLanguage, go, storageService, gettext, platformInfo, ongoingProcess) { + function($rootScope, $scope, $timeout, $log, $ionicSideMenuDelegate, profileService, applicationService, gettextCatalog, uxLanguage, go, storageService, gettext, platformInfo, ongoingProcess) { var self = this; self.tries = 0; var isCordova = platformInfo.isCordova; @@ -62,6 +62,7 @@ angular.module('copayApp.controllers').controller('disclaimerController', if (err) $log.error(err); else { $ionicSideMenuDelegate.canDragContent(true); + $rootScope.$emit('disclaimerAccepted'); go.walletHome(); } }); diff --git a/src/js/controllers/index.js b/src/js/controllers/index.js index 8e84d190a..58903f302 100644 --- a/src/js/controllers/index.js +++ b/src/js/controllers/index.js @@ -61,6 +61,12 @@ angular.module('copayApp.controllers').controller('indexController', function($r }); } + $timeout(function() { + profileService.isDisclaimerAccepted(function(val) { + $scope.isDisclaimerAccepted = val; + }); + }, 1); + function strip(number) { return (parseFloat(number.toPrecision(12))); }; @@ -1410,6 +1416,12 @@ angular.module('copayApp.controllers').controller('indexController', function($r self.tab = 'walletHome'; }); + $rootScope.$on('disclaimerAccepted', function(event) { + profileService.isDisclaimerAccepted(function(val) { + $scope.isDisclaimerAccepted = val; + }); + }); + $rootScope.$on('Local/ValidatingWalletEnded', function(ev, walletId, isOK) { if (self.isInFocus(walletId)) {